The historic Chelsea Clocktower is part of the Chelsea Clocktower Complex, a 127,600 SF landmark development. Significantly renovated in the early
2000's, the complex has a mix of office, restaurant, medical and light industrial users. The Chelsea Complex includes shared common grounds w/ sunken fountain
courtyard, gazebo, outdoor seating, brick walkways and stonework and meticulous landscaping throughout.
Area Description The City of Chelsea is located just 2 miles from 1-94; 16 miles from Ann Arbor; 23 miles from Jackson, 28 miles from Brighton, 40 miles from Livonia and
46 miles from Detroit Metro Airport, which ensures it is a convenient location for both hosting out of town guests and for attracting and retaining employees. Chelsea has
small town character with plenty of culture and recreation. With numerous art galleries, restaurants (like The Comm on Grill), the famous Purple Rose Theatre (founded by
actor Jeff Daniels), an award-winning library, a historic downtown, numerous festivals, community events and much more, it is the ideal place for businesses, visitors and
residents alike. Chelsea is also home to the 3,850-acre Chrysler Proving Grounds, Wind Tunnel and Test Labs. In comparing cost of living, Ann Arbor is 9% more expensive
than Chelsea. Housing costs in Ann Arbor are also 23% higher.
